Seeing as your tank is only a 20, it will be subject to more fluctuations in water quality, temp, etc...  harder to find its groove, stability-wise.  I have a 20 with a baby BTA now in there now, and it is more challenging than my other tank, and more work... 
 
My ocellaris clowns did great for almost a year without any anemone - they liked soft corals, and especially LPS (Hammer, Forgspawn, etc).  Anemone not necessary, but I'm glad to have got one after almost a year and a half.
